Energy calculated at B2PLYP/6-31G*
 hartrees
Energy at 0K-196.264283
Energy at 298.15K-196.275091
HF Energy-196.048252
Nuclear repulsion energy184.347574
The energy at 298.15K was derived from the energy at 0K and an integrated heat capacity that used the calculated vibrational frequencies.
